About The Position

Wells Fargo is seeking a Senior Business Execution Consultant / Learning and Development Facilitator within the Training & Access Management function of Fraud & Claims Management (FCM). This position supports the learning and development needs of critical Fraud and Claims business functions, helping ensure frontline employees have the knowledge, skills, and resources needed to deliver exceptional customer service while meeting regulatory and operational requirements. The role involves partnering closely with business leaders, subject matter experts, and Enterprise Learning & Development teams to design, deliver, and facilitate training programs that drive workforce readiness and performance. This position supports teams across Claims & Recovery and Fraud Detection Operations, including Credit Card Claims, Debit/ACH/Check Claims, Online Claims, Recovery & Restitution Processing, Identity Theft Assistance, Fraud Alert Investigation, Account Takeover Investigations, Online Banking Fraud, Payment Fraud, and other high-risk fraud prevention and detection functions. The Senior Business Execution Consultant / Learning and Development Facilitator will create and maintain learning content, facilitate instructor-led and virtual training programs, manage classroom delivery, and support onboarding and transition initiatives. They will collaborate with line-of-business partners to identify skill gaps, develop learning solutions, and ensure employees are prepared to navigate complex customer situations, mitigate risk, and maintain compliance with business and regulatory requirements.
